I wrote a lot of poetry back during my undergrad days, but once I found that I enjoyed doing fiction more, I never picked it back up (despite filling a huge notebook with well-transcribed versions along with accompanying images). Since Steemit seems to have a thriving (and growing) poetry community, I thought I'd add a little fuel to that particular fire. I hope you enjoy :)


Oedipus saw right through me tonight
And left his eyeball on my dresser -
An unwanted guardian to watch over.

Predict me my future, show me my fate
Get it over with so I can decide
Whether I want to change it or not.

Spin me a riddle and every time I answer
I'll give you the wrong one.
As long as you laugh, it's okay.
